What young career researchers can learn from Mabel’s success

Mabel Day

Ever wondered how to get your research noticed? PhD candidate Mabel Day did it through Falling Walls Lab, winning the national competition for her work on breaking down toxic "forever chemicals". Next, she's off to Berlin to shine a light on the global stage.

UoA achieves net zero emissions

Maths Lawn

Achieving net zero operations means that the greenhouse gas emissions from our directly controlled activities are now balanced by removing an equivalent amount of emissions from the atmosphere.
